Hart's double-double propels 'Cats to victory

Indianapolis, Ind. – If you still haven’t picked up a mega millions lottery ticket, you can be sure to bet on lucky number three. Powerball Josh Hart’s second straight double-double (22 points, 11 rebounds) led to a 60-55 win against Butler at Hinkle Fieldhouse last night, redeeming the Wildcats after their lowest scoring half of the season.

“We just love playing here,” stated Villanova head coach Jay Wright. “We have so much respect for [Butler].”

Foul trouble and cold shooting on Villanova’s end combined with impressive Butler defense kept it a low-scoring game at the half, showing 27-21 on the scoreboard in the home team’s favor.
